As good as it gets in EU law October 8, 2007 keely (plymouth) I don't know why it is that nobody seems able to write a book on EU law that is explains the law in simple terms without over simplifying it. All books in the area either seem to leave you just as confused as when you started or to give you a false sense that you understand things becasue they reduce it all to its simplist possible terms. This book is the best that I could find at providing clear and simple explanations that enable you to get your head round the law. The diagrams really help too and give you an way of puzzling through the law until you get to the point of understanding that is needed. I still thought that there was room to make it a more effective learning tool for students by doing things like noting what points are essentially established as fact and what is open to debate discussion but you can't have everything. THis was the fourth EU book that I bought but the first of the four that I didn't send back as being no use whatsoever so its clearly goind something right.
